One of the construction developments in Indonesia is the Kediri Regency Stadium construction project. In every construction project, it is very important to implement Occupational Safety and Health making it a primary concern. This is to anticipate negative impacts, such as increasing absenteeism rates, decreasing productivity, increasing medical costs, as well as a form of controlling all risks of work accidents in the work environment. This impact causes losses for both workers and contractor companies. Therefore, identification, assessment and analysis must be carried out to be able to control the risk of work accidents. The aim of this research is to identify risk factors for work accidents, assess the risk of work accidents, and control risks in the Kediri Regency Stadium construction project. The research method used is the Hazard Analysis and Operability Study (HAZOP) method. The results of this research were 45 risk factors, 29 of which were valid, and the results obtained were 2 extreme risks, 3 high risks, 17 mederate risks and 7 low risks. Apart from that, according to the risk control hierarchy, there are 3 types of risk control that can be applied in this research.
